Output de575da26abd4161a58b6a832731cfe55f7cec103dde638960c4546e1b5b12d5:1

value
66563153
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87cc94df5617ceaea8dc53680748ad964304d839 OP_EQUALVERIFY OP_CHECKSIG
address
1DP3JUL95m2QH9yMtX2AYzJdKcTyNJcmbH
transaction
de575da26abd4161a58b6a832731cfe55f7cec103dde638960c4546e1b5b12d5
confirmations
439195
spent
true